Coverage for a Newborn Child. All health coverage applicable for children under this contract will be provided for a newborn child of a member or to a member’s covered family member from the moment of birth if the newborn is enrolled timely as specified in the Special Enrollment provision. The coverage, benefits or services for newborns shall consist of coverage for injury or sickness, including the necessary care or treatment of medically diagnosed congenital defects, birth abnormalities or pre- maturity and up to $1,000 transportation costs of the newborn to and from the nearest appropriate facility staffed and equipped to treat the newborn’s condition when such transportation is certified by the treating provider as necessary to protect the health and safety of the newborn child. Additional premium will be required to continue coverage beyond the 31st day after the date of birth of the child. The required premium will be calculated from the child's date of birth. If notice of the newborn is given to us by the Marketplace within the 31 days from birth, an additional premium for coverage of the newborn child will be charged for 31 days from the birth of the child. If notice is not given with the 31 days from birth, we will charge an additional premium from the date of birth. If notice is given by the Marketplace within 60 days of the birth of the child, the contract may not deny coverage of the child due to failure to notify us of the birth of the child or to pre-enroll the child Coverage for An Adopted Child Coverage for children under this contract will be provided for the adopted child of a member who has family coverage in force. Coverage is provided to a child the member proposes to adopt who is placed in the member’s residence in compliance with chapter 63, from the moment of placement. A newborn infant who is adopted by the member is covered from the moment of birth if a written agreement to adopt such child has been entered into prior to the birth of the child, whether or not such agreement is enforceable. However, coverage will not be provided in the event the child is not ultimately placed in the member’s residence in compliance with chapter 63, Florida Statutes. The member’s adopted child is covered from the moment of placement in the residence, or if a newborn, from the moment of birth, if the child is enrolled timely as specified in the Special Enrollment Period provision. Additional premium will be required to continue coverage beyond the 31st day following placement of the child and where the issuer is notified by the Marketplace. The required premium will be calculated from the date of placement for adoption. Coverage of the child will terminate on the 31st day following placement, unless we have received both: (A) Notification of the addition of the child from the Marketplace within 60 days of the birth or placement and (B) any additional premium required for the addition of the child within 90 days of the date of placement
